    Message : Use visitor pattern for Shader Variable APIs. In many places in ANGLE we need to traverse a ShaderVariable tree. We do this to store uniform offset and other information, to flatten the tree of uniforms for the front-end, or to produce active variable lists for uniform and shader storage blocks. In each case, we would write separate tree traversal code. This patch introduces a shared visitor pattern for all of the shader variable tree traversal instances. With that get more common code. Also it is easier to write new variable traversals. ProgramD3D and ProgramLinkedResources in particular get nice simplificiations. The visitor object recieves callbacks from the traversal when entering structs, array elements, and new variables. The visitor can treat these differently depending on the use case. A common visitor that constructs full variable names is used as a base class in several places. Also moves the 'isRowMajorLayout' from sh::InterfaceBlockField to sh::ShaderVariable. This allows us to forgo using templates in several call sites.
